How Lynwood's History Shapes Tree Care Today
Lynwood grew rapidly as a post-World War II suburban community, and that history still affects tree maintenance today. Aging root systems can lift sidewalks and stress foundations, overgrown canopies can conflict with power lines, and trees that have gone too long without care often require specialized attention.

Invasive Root Systems Damaging Hardscapes
Mature trees add shade and beauty, but they can also create problems when roots spread under sidewalks and driveways. If left alone, ficus and eucalyptus roots may crack concrete and create trip hazards across residential streets.

Coastal Wind Patterns and Drought Stress
Santa Ana winds and periodic drought conditions in the Los Angeles region put added stress on trees, increasing the chance of branch failure and decline.
Experienced teams respond with deep root watering systems, pruning techniques that improve wind resistance, and recommendations for drought-tolerant species to support stability and weather protection.

Intensive Tree Pruning Services in Lynwood, CA
- Structural Pruning for Young Trees: Build strong branch structure early to reduce future problems and lower long-term maintenance needs.
- Vista Pruning for View Restoration: Carefully remove select branches to reopen views without harming tree health.
- Storm Damage Restoration: Repair trees impacted by strong winds or severe weather by removing broken limbs and reshaping the canopy for ongoing growth.
- Clearance Pruning for Buildings: Maintain safe spacing between branches and roofs to help protect shingles, gutters, and siding.
- Fruit Tree Maintenance: Support better fruit production and healthier trees with pruning methods designed for backyard orchards.
Targeted pruning helps correct structural concerns and can extend the useful life of your landscape investment.
Maintenance Tree Services in Lynwood, CA
- Root System Management: Address surface roots that damage sidewalks while maintaining tree stability and health through selective pruning and barrier installation.
- Disease and Pest Treatment: Spot and manage common regional problems such as aphids, scale insects, and fungal infections before they spread.
- Cabling and Bracing Installation: Add support to trees with weak branch unions or split trunks to extend their safe lifespan.
- Soil Aeration and Fertilization: Improve nutrient uptake and root health in compacted urban soils often found in established neighborhoods.
- Mulching and Moisture Management: Set up proper mulch rings and irrigation practices to help trees handle dry conditions.
Ongoing maintenance keeps small issues from turning into expensive emergencies while protecting your property and neighborhood character.
